“Everything arrived exactly as ordered and packaged well. First impression — the glove looks and feels like a quality product. The leather and overall construction seem very solid.
One thing to note: this glove is extremely stiff out of the box. It’s going to take a serious break-in period, so it’s probably not ideal for beginners who need something game-ready quickly.
That said, once it’s fully broken in, I think it has the potential to be a really good glove. I’ll be able to give a more complete review after some more use, but based on first look and feel, it definitely appears to be a quality piece.”
